Azure SQL: Does Azure SQL Database offer a free tier?

Yes, Azure SQL Database includes a permanent free tier that provides 100,000 vCore seconds, 32 GB of data storage, and 32 GB of backup storage per month. This free tier is available for the lifetime of any Azure subscription with no expiration.

Apache Spark MLlib: How much does Apache Spark MLlib cost?

MLlib is completely free and open source, licensed under the Apache License Version 2.0. There are no subscription, licensing, or usage fees.

Azure SQL: What pricing models does Azure SQL Database support?

Azure SQL Database offers consumption-based pricing where you pay for resources used, with no long-term commitments required. Database Savings Plans launched in March 2026 allow committing to a fixed hourly amount and save up to 35% across Azure database services.

Azure SQL: Is Azure SQL Database compatible with on-premises SQL Server?

Yes, Azure SQL Database shares the same Database Engine as on-premises SQL Server. Existing databases maintain their compatibility level and continue to work after upgrades. Azure SQL Managed Instance provides even broader SQL Server compatibility dating back to SQL Server 2008.

Apache Spark MLlib: How do I use MLlib?

MLlib is built into Apache Spark. Download Spark, which includes MLlib as a module, and deploy on your choice of infrastructure including Hadoop, Mesos, Kubernetes, standalone, or cloud.

Azure SQL: What high availability features does Azure SQL Database provide?

Azure SQL Database provides automatic backups, geo-replication for disaster recovery, failover groups for automatic failover, and zone redundancy for enhanced availability. The service maintains a 99.99% availability SLA for Business Critical tier.
